California Governor signs three nuclear safeguard bills

Gov. Edmund G. Brown Jr approves a package of three safeguards as a moderated approach to nuclear safety. The bills apply to future development and would be void if Prop 15 passes, leaving current plants and pending projects under review by the Energy Commission and Legislature. Brown avoids endorsing Prop 15, signaling the people will decide.

Albert forms panel to study House committee spending

Washington, UPI Albert, speaker of the House, names a three member panel to review how committees spend funds amid allegations that Rep. Wayne Hays used federal money to hire a mistress. The group led by Rep. David Obey will report to the party leadership and consider extra billing concerns and potential conflicts of interest.

Ambulance subsidy to be debated by county board

Francis H Beattie vows to vote against eliminating subsidies as Johnson and Gambetta push a plan to end county aid for ambulances. The proposal cites a 10 to 12 year program costing 72000 yearly countywide and seeks user pays to cover true indigents amid a regional price war impacting Santa Ynez Solvang Buellton Lompoc areas.

Ford and Reagan clash over Rhodesia remarks in campaign

President Ford denounces Ronald Reagan as irresponsible for suggesting potential U.S. troop involvement in southern Africa while Reagan says his comments were misrepresented and aims to help resolve Rhodesia’s internal conflict. Also notes Carter’s Ohio push and Church and Udall comments amid primary season.

May unemployment rate dips to 7.3 percent in U S

The Labor Department reports May jobs rose to a record 87.7 million while the unemployment rate fell to 7.3 percent. Wholesale prices rose 0.3 percent, driven by incentives cutting auto dealer and home-building material costs, easing inflation concerns and aiding President Ford ahead of GOP primaries.

Syrian troops advance toward Mount Lebanon amid Lebanon fighting

Syrian forces moved from the Bekka Valley toward Mount Lebanon and occupied lines near Tarshish as clashes raged across the countryside. Beirut reports say leftist defenses withdrew without resistance while Lebanese Arab Army calls for delegations from Syria, Libya, and Algeria to pursue talks. The Soviet visit to confirm Iraq and Soviet aims did not address Syria’s intervention.
